Output 57a2d2ffe68a98626fadcccf74741e1e02b0c5d112cac734b8e1f0d85a93aca3:22

value
6300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e0e14b56e0de814b1ed95ec5b82d9cdc7878e05 OP_EQUAL
address
AFbbAUM3UKBZDpDRF57fMjSJHFxdtGqX5J
transaction
57a2d2ffe68a98626fadcccf74741e1e02b0c5d112cac734b8e1f0d85a93aca3